A train running at the speed of 60 km / hr crosses a pole in 30 seconds. What is the length of the train?
Given: Speed of the train = 60 km/hr Time is taken by a train of crossing a pole = 30 seconds Concept used: The distance travelled by train will be its length. Formula used: Distance = speed × time 1 km = 1000 metre And 1 hour = 3600 seconds Calculation: Length of the train = […]
